OpenAI brings in consultants to promote the company

OpenAI is an AI company aiming to grow enterprise businesses in 2026, strengthening its partnerships with four leading consulting companies.

OpenAI announced the Frontier Alliance on Monday. This shows that AI Lab is willing to try different approaches to get companies to meaningfully adopt its technology. The collaboration includes a multi-year partnership between OpenAI and four leading consulting firms, Boston Consulting Group (BCG), McKinsey, Accenture, and Capgemini, to sell enterprise products.

OpenAI’s Forward Deployment Engineering team works with consulting giants to help customers implement OpenAI’s enterprise technologies, such as OpenAI Frontier, into their customers’ technology stacks.

The company launched OpenAI Frontier in early February. Open, code-free software allows users to build, deploy, and manage AI agents built on OpenAI’s AI models and other models.

In its latest announcement, OpenAI argues that consultants are the right way to get companies on board.

“AI will not be the only driver of change. It must be tied to strategy, embedded in redesigned processes, and deployed at scale with incentives and culture aligned to deliver sustainable results,” BCG CEO Christoph Schweitzer said in an OpenAI blog post. “Our expanded partnership combines OpenAI’s Frontier platform with BCG’s deep industry, functional and technology expertise, and BCG X’s building and scaling capabilities to help you stay safe and drive measurable impact from day one.”

So far, enterprise adoption of AI has been relatively slow as companies have struggled to find a meaningful return on investment from pursuing AI.

OpenAI’s partnership strategy makes sense and goes beyond simply selling companies to embed AI into their existing workflows. Instead, the effort is focused on consultants convincing companies to change their strategies and workflows to incorporate OpenAI’s tools where it makes sense.

It’s worth noting that OpenAI’s rival Anthropic has also signed deals with consulting giants like Deloitte and Accenture in recent months.

The company’s CFO Sarah Friar said in a January blog post that enterprise will be a big focus area for OpenAI in 2026. OpenAI also signed large enterprise AI deals with Snowflake and ServiceNow so far this year, in addition to appointing Barrett Zoff to lead the company’s enterprise sales operations in January.
